Okhotnik — Soviet special premium Tier V destroyer.
The Naval General Staff designed the Novik-class destroyers for use in tandem with Svetlana-class light cruisers; however, completion of the latter was delayed. For that reason, Vice-Admiral Adrian Nepenin, the commander of the Baltic Fleet, turned to the Naval General Staff with a request to install six or seven 130 mm guns on modified Gogland-class destroyers that were being built at the time.

Player Opinion
Pros:
- A very large amount of guns for a destroyer.
- Very stealthy for a Soviet destroyer.
- The HE shells hit hard and are good at starting fires.
- Has a decent amount of hit points for its tier.
Cons:
- Poor rate of fire.
- Slow turret traverse.
- Very poor maneuverability; slowest of all the T5 Soviet destroyers and has a massive turning circle.
- Short firing range.
- Torpedoes have very short range.

Upgrades
Okhotnik will really only gain substantial benefit from a handful of the upgrades available to her. Main Armaments Modification 1 in Upgrade Slot 1, Aiming Systems Modification 1 in Upgrade Slot 2, and Propulsion Modification 1 in Upgrade Slot 4 are the recommended picks. Some captains may find Main Battery Modification 2 might be worthwhile in Slot 2; it improves her turret traverse notably for only an extra 0.5 second increase in her main battery reload time.

Camouflage
As a premium ship, Okhotnik comes included with Type 9 camouflage that lowers her detection radius, reduces the accuracy of incoming shells, and increases the amount of experience she earns.
